Christianity and Depression 

Support
Offering a theological and biblical account of depression, this book considers how depression has been understood and interpreted by Christians and how plausible and pastorally helpful these understandings are. It offers an important and well-informed resource for those with, or preparing for, positions of pastoral responsibility within the Christian Church

About the author

Tasia Scrutton is an Associate Professor in Philosophy and Religion at the University of Leeds. She is the author of ‘Thinking through Feeling: God, Emotion and Passibility’
